titleOfInvention | An enzyme-linked immunosorbent assay kit for detecting dicofol and its application |
abstract | The invention discloses an enzyme-linked immunosorbent assay kit for detecting dicofol, comprising: an enzyme label plate coated with a dicofol-coated antigen, a dicofol monoclonal antibody, an enzyme-labeled anti-antibody, a dicofol standard solution, and a substrate color developing solution , stop solution, washing solution, reconstitution solution. The invention also discloses a method for detecting dicofol by using the enzyme-linked immunosorbent assay kit, which comprises: firstly pre-processing the sample, then using the kit to detect, and finally analyzing the detection result. The enzyme-linked immunosorbent assay kit provided by the invention can be used to detect the residual amount of dicofol in vegetables, fruits and tea leaves, and has many advantages such as rapidity, simple operation, low cost, high sensitivity, strong specificity, etc., and is suitable for large-scale batches of basic laboratories Sample detection and field rapid screening of agricultural products can control the circulation of contaminated agricultural products from the source. |
